When two i2c controllers are internally connected to the same
GPIO pins, the arb clock is needed to ensure that the waveforms
do not interfere with each other.

Add i2c compatible for MT8183. Compare to MT2712 i2c controller,
MT8183 has different register offsets. Ltiming_reg is added to
adjust low width of SCL. Arb clock and dma_sync are needed.

Matthias wasn't super happy with this. One way is to add another field
in the compatible string. Another may be to have
mt_i2c_regs_v1[OFFSET_LTIMING] point at, say 0xffff (#define this as
I2C_REG_INVALID or something), and test for that?

Either way would scale better if we end up with more than 2 versions
of the register set in the future.

Yes, old and new SoC have the I2C_ARB_LOST bit, but there was no need
for multi-master before, so we didn't set it up specifically, I have
test the patch on the old SoCs. I will add a note in the commit message.
